Today's guest post is by Christine from MSodapop blog and she shares with us her top 5 drugstore lip products. For more on Christine read about her at the end of this post.




From left to right:
  1. Covergirl Outlast Smoothwear lip liner in Ruby is my go-to lip product when I want to wear a red lip. I don't just use it as a lip liner, but also as an all over lip color. It glides on smoothly to my lips and it's very pigmented.
  2. E.L.F. Glossy Gloss in Pink Candy is a really nice baby pink lip gloss. It is opaque and it is not sticky like some lip glosses tend to be, so if you don't like sticky lip glosses, definitely give this one a try.
  3. Burt's Bees Tinted Lip Balm in Pink Blossom is the one lip product that I always take with me on the go. It's a beautiful bubble gum pink tinted lip balm that is moisturizing and 100% natural. The combination of the color and the moisture revives my dull lips throughout the day.
  4. Wet n Wild Mega Last lip color lipstick in Just Peachy is a matte lip stick that has a nude pink peach color. My lips don't cooperate very well with matte lip sticks but I love this shade too much. I just put lip balm on prior to putting this on. If you like matte lipsticks, you should definitely give this a try.
  5. Revlon Colorburst Lip Butter in Creamsicle is probably a product that most of you, if not all of you, know about. I definitely love the Revlon lip butters because they're a lip balm and a lipstick in one. I love this shade in particular because it gives me a nice creamy nude lip.
